How DIY Projects Create More Waste Than Anticipated

DIY projects are often approached with a focus on creativity, cost savings, and hands-

on involvement. Homeowners take on tasks like removing old flooring, updating

kitchens, building outdoor structures, or clearing out storage areas with the expectation

that the work will be manageable over a weekend or a few days. What many do not

anticipate, however, is how quickly waste begins to accumulate once the project is

underway.

From demolition debris to packaging materials, DIY projects tend to generate more

waste than expected. Understanding why this happens can help homeowners plan

more effectively and avoid disruptions mid-project.

The Hidden Volume of Demolition Debris

Many DIY projects begin with removing existing materials. Tearing out cabinets, pulling

up flooring, or dismantling fixtures creates an immediate surge of debris. What might

seem like a small space—such as a bathroom or closet—can produce multiple piles of

material once everything is removed.

Older materials can also be heavier and bulkier than anticipated. Tile, plaster, and wood

components take up significant space when broken apart. As these materials

accumulate, homeowners often find that standard trash bins are insufficient.

The volume generated during this initial phase is one of the main reasons waste quickly

exceeds expectations.

Packaging Adds Up Quickly

DIY projects rarely involve just the materials being installed. Each item

purchased—whether it is flooring, hardware, or tools—arrives with packaging that must

be disposed of. Cardboard boxes, plastic wrap, foam inserts, and protective coverings

can pile up just as fast as demolition debris.

Because packaging is lighter, it is often underestimated. However, when combined with

other materials, it contributes to the overall volume that needs to be managed.

Failing to account for packaging waste can leave homeowners scrambling for disposal

solutions.

Mistakes and Material Overages

DIY work often involves a learning curve. Cuts may need to be redone, measurements

adjusted, or materials replaced due to installation errors. These situations create

additional waste that was not part of the original plan.

Even experienced homeowners may order extra materials to ensure they have enough

to complete the project. While this helps avoid delays, it can also lead to leftover pieces

that must be discarded.

These factors contribute to a higher-than-expected amount of debris as the project

progresses.

Underestimating Project Scope

One of the most common reasons DIY projects generate excess waste is scope

expansion. What starts as a simple update can evolve into a larger renovation once

hidden issues are uncovered. Removing a section of drywall may reveal additional

repairs, or replacing flooring may lead to subfloor work.

As the scope increases, so does the volume of materials being removed and replaced.

Homeowners who did not initially plan for this expansion may find themselves dealing

with more debris than they anticipated.

Planning for flexibility helps account for these unexpected changes.

Limited Disposal Capacity at Home

Residential trash collection is typically designed for everyday waste, not construction

debris. Standard bins fill quickly when used for DIY project materials, especially during

demolition phases.

Bulk items and heavier materials may not be accepted through regular pickup services,

requiring alternative disposal methods. Without a plan in place, homeowners may end

up storing debris temporarily in garages, driveways, or yards.

This can create clutter and slow down progress as space becomes limited.

The Impact on Workflow and Efficiency

Excess debris does more than create clutter—it can affect how efficiently a project

moves forward. Piles of material can block access to work areas, making it harder to

complete tasks. Homeowners may need to pause work to clear space, adding time to

the overall project.

By anticipating waste volume and planning for removal, homeowners can maintain a

smoother workflow. Keeping the workspace clear allows for better focus and more

consistent progress.

Efficient debris management supports a more productive DIY experience.

Safety Considerations

Accumulated debris can also introduce safety risks. Sharp edges, loose materials, and

uneven piles increase the likelihood of trips and injuries. This is particularly important in

smaller spaces where movement is already limited.

Regular cleanup helps reduce these risks and creates a safer environment for

completing the project. Removing waste consistently also improves visibility, making it

easier to work with precision.

Safety and organization go hand in hand during DIY projects.

Preparing for Final Cleanup

As a DIY project nears completion, the final cleanup phase can be more demanding

than expected if debris has not been managed throughout the process. Removing large

amounts of accumulated waste at once requires additional time and effort.

Planning for ongoing cleanup helps reduce the burden of final disposal and allows

homeowners to transition more quickly from construction to enjoying the finished space.

A well-managed cleanup process makes the completion stage far more manageable.

DIY projects often generate more waste than anticipated due to demolition, packaging,

material overages, and unexpected scope changes. Without proper planning, this debris

can slow progress and create challenges throughout the project.

By recognizing these factors and incorporating waste management into the planning

process, homeowners can maintain cleaner workspaces, improve efficiency, and

complete their projects with fewer interruptions.
